Job Description :

POSITION: Software Developer, Applications (Oracle/ PL/SQL Developer)


Interact with all stake holders of billing analytics project to gather business requirement during product development and enhancement.
Follow agile methodology to gather business requirement on wireless and wireline business domain Received general instructions on non-routine work assignments from stakeholders.
Perform research and designing of proof of concept to migrate billing application component from on premise Oracle and J2EE application servers to AMAZON AWS EC2 and RDS cloud database severs independently. Main goal is to achieve more cost effective highly efficient, secure and super responsive system.
Adapt latest cloud technologies like Amazon EC2 application servers, RDS db like Maira db and MySQL db, Aurora db, CICD pipelines, Jenkin jobs, aurora compatible PostgreSQL etc. and best practices of AWS framework; thereafter implement those practices into legacy applications to renovate the system all together
Adapt Oracle as well as Aurora Postgresql performance tuning and various query optimization techniques, analytical functions and supported very large-scale databases (5TB
Work as individual contributor as well as in a team setting within a matrix organization.
Demonstrate all pros and cons of newly adapted AWS technologies to all business stakeholders during before/ during/after the application migration process.
Receive and deliver adhoc business domain and technology level training as per job requirement
Educate business stakeholders on each enhancement or applications during each phase of sdlc life cycle i.e. analysis, design, coding, testing, deployment, maintenance.
Prepare detailed functional specification documents for each business requirement changes or new development or enhancement requests.
Work with technical architect to come up with detailed technical design document and get those documents approved by manager.
Prepare test cases and to test the system after completion of development.
Work in onsite/offshore model to prepare and review testcases and coordinated different activities for the same.
Work with QA analyst and business subject matter expert to get test cases and test results certified for each enhancement and development task.
Provide requirement clarification to all development team in day-to-day basis Worked in onsite/offshore model to share development work and monitored the progress of development.
Act as a liaison between business stakeholder and IT development team, QA analyst as well as business subject matter expert.
Involved in complete end to end system testing to ensure system works as expected.
Application code is written by Oracle PL/SQL, Unix, Java Spring batch, Postgresql; job scheduling is performed using Linux crontab and daemon jobs; monitoring and analyzing Java / Oracle 12c application performance performed through Wily, performance matrix tables and AWS CloudWatch.
Work with business stake holder during UAT and Go-Live, validate the system and give a go for the system readiness.

Other similar professional responsibilities may also be assigned.



Bachelor''s degree or equivalent in Computer Science (CS), Information Technology (IT), Information Systems (IS), Computer Engineering (CE), Informatics, or Software Engineering (SE), or closely related field + 5 year experience in job offered or related.

HOURS: 40 hrs per week daytime, Full-Time

CONTACT: Email :